Who can join

Adults 18 to 65, any sex, with Patients With Non-Specific Chronic Neck Pain.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.

Sponsor's own description

The study was conducted to determine and compare the effects of the therapeutic exercises and stabilization exercises given to the patient after the manual therapy session on pain, neck range of motion, daily living activities and quality of life.
